Rapid Prototyping by Selective CO2 Laser Sintering Using Bronze Powder

  • Kim Jae Do

초록

A prototying process based on the technique of selective CO2 laser sintering has been carried out using bronze powder. The integration of a CO2 laser and a working table to create the opto-mechanical system has been constructed for making the multi-layer sintering. Three dimensional rapid prototyping process has been investigated experimentally using 40W CO2 laser. The optimal scanning method has been found to minimize the deflection and distortion by using the thermal strain method which the laser scans in x and y directions repeatedly. The method of spreading powder has been improved by the rubber knife of which the flexibility causes fewer waves on the surface.
